Starting Early to Catch Dolphins at Lovina Beach

The tour kicks off bright and early at 4:00 am, with pickup arranged from your Ubud accommodation. The first highlight is Lovina Beach, renowned for its wild dolphins. The two-hour drive from south Bali offers a scenic start, giving you a glimpse of rural Bali and its lush landscapes. Once there, you can opt for an outrigger boat ride costing around 200,000-250,000 IDR per person. We love that this part feels authentic—there’s no staged dolphin show here; you’re genuinely watching wild dolphins in their natural environment.

This activity is about 1.5 hours of your day. While the admission is free, the boat ride is an additional expense, which can be a worthwhile splurge if dolphins are your main goal. Some reviews mention that this early start allows for better chances of seeing dolphins, and the calm morning waters make the experience more enjoyable.

Visiting Aling-Aling Waterfall

Next, the tour moves to Aling-Aling Waterfall, a stunning cascade tucked away in North Bali. The waterfall offers a peaceful spot for photos, swimming, or simply soaking in the lush surroundings. It’s a favorite stop for nature lovers, though note that admission tickets are not included, so you’ll need to pay at the entrance if you want to go closer or swim.

Traveling here takes about two hours, so be prepared for a scenic drive through Bali’s mountainous terrain. The waterfall’s beauty lies in its pristine, less crowded environment, offering a stark contrast to the busier southern beaches.

Wanagiri Hidden Hills and Twin Lake Views

After the waterfall, you’ll visit Wanagiri Hidden Hills, a popular selfie spot perched above twin lakes. It’s a compact stop—around 30 minutes—but packed with photo opportunities of panoramic views. This spot is all about capturing that perfect Instagram shot, so bring your camera or phone fully charged.

Many visitors comment on the breathtaking vistas, making it a highlight for landscape and nature photography. While the admission ticket isn’t included, the view alone justifies the stop.

Handara Iconic Gate

Next up, the famous Handara Gate provides one of Bali’s most recognizable photo backdrops. The gate’s traditional Balinese architecture frames lush greenery and mountain views, making it a favorite for travelers wanting an iconic shot. Again, about 30 minutes is enough time here to take your photos, soak in the atmosphere, and learn about local architecture.

Lake Beratan and the Small Temple

Your last stop is Lake Beratan, home to a small, picturesque temple on the water. The peaceful setting and reflections on the lake make for stunning photos and a serene experience. The tour allows roughly an hour here, giving enough time to explore the temple area and enjoy the scenery.

The tour is private—meaning only your group will participate—which offers a more relaxed experience. The pickup time at 4:00 am means an early start but also the chance to beat crowds and enjoy the sites in cooler, less busy conditions.

The cost is $40 per person, which covers transportation, the guide, and most stops. The dolphin boat ride is paid separately, and you should budget for this if it’s a priority. The group discounts make it an economical choice for families or groups.

While the tour is mostly suitable for most travelers, note that WiFi access can be spotty, as noted by one reviewer, which could be frustrating if you’re trying to stay connected or share your photos instantly. The tour’s duration is approximately 7 to 10 hours, offering plenty of time to enjoy each stop without feeling rushed.
